Brian Neal here out of Chicago where I found out the Bears lost in dramatic fashion. They had tons of opportunities and failed to take advantage time after time. Brian Griese started off very slow against the Lions but in the 2nd quarter exploded with very good numbers, sad enough to say though, but he didn't end that way. Throwing 3 INT's and 2 TD's. Also completed only about 54% of his passes. Now I ask you why did they switch from Grossman to Griese? They both had terrible numbers, and still questions about the Chicago Bears still need to be answered, but no one has any idea when that will be. The only thing good I have to report about the team is that Devin Hester is at it again with his lightening speed had his 2nd return TD of the season. It was a KR this time, and expect to see him starting in the pro-bowl for his 2nd consecutive year. This is Brian Neal, UIML reporter.
